Rod Stasick is a composer in the broad sense of the term. He is interested in the creation of event-systems for various situations. Template scores are often created using a combination of graphic signs and symbols that usually suggests a syncretism of styles and methods of performance. Using these methods, he produces works in diverse disciplines (audio, video, text, mail art, conceptualism, etc.) utilizing assorted influences: Eastern Philosophy, Fluxus, The Internationale Situationniste, Oulipo, Semiotics, Discrete Event-Systems, random numbers to revamp Zen planning and various forms of Information Theory. He has also performed an extensive number of experimental works by other composers. His recent studies with Karlheinz Stockhausen (2001-2007) have renewed his interest in various aspects of compositional integration.
